About This Home

Well-located up-and-down duplex on St Pauls East Side featuring two large two-story, 2-bedroom units with strong long-term rental appeal. Situated on a quiet dead-end street, the property offers a unique combination of privacy, accessibility, and functional tenant amenities in a stable rental neighborhood with continued demand. Residents enjoy convenient access to downtown St Paul, public transportation, Mississippi Market Co-Op, and the restaurants, shopping, and entertainment along East 7th Street. The property also includes a large detached garage accessed from the alley, providing valuable off-street tenant parking and additional utility uncommon for similar duplex properties. Utilities are currently partially owner-paid, with ownership implementing a RUBS utility reimbursement program across the portfolio beginning Q3 2026. Future ownership will have the opportunity to improve NOI through utility cost recovery and operational efficiencies. Excellent opportunity for investors seeking stable cash flow with long-term value-add potential.
